Stuck on TELUS network


Hi,

For the past week my iPhone says TELUS. Everyone else I know who is on Koodo their iphones says Koodo. I know Telus owns Koodo but still. On the network selection I only have Telus, Bell and Videotron.

How do I fix this?

Thanks!

Best answer by avery480

hi @Flo Koodo,

I tried my sim card in another phone and still the same issue. I just changed my sim card for a new one and now it says koodo :).

Hi there,

Have you tried power cycling the device? This is sometimes a phone glitch when it reads the signal coming from the tower and interprets it as Telus. You’re correct, Telus owns Koodo so when they share networks this sometimes happens. If that doesn’t work you can also try resetting the network settings in your phone, though even if it shows Telus it shouldn’t affect your service 🙂👍
